Local arm of German retailer METRO Cash & Carry that runs 27 wholesale stores in the country selling staples, fresh produce and other packaged and household goods to small retailers, shopkeepers, businesses and restaurants, said the current three-week lockdown has disrupted movement of essential goods.
Arvind Mediratta, managing director and chief executive officer of the company, who is also the chair of FICCI's committee on retail and internal trade and co-chair of food processing committee at CII, spoke with Mint about the covid-19 impact and what consumers are buying.
